Ho Chi Minh City VNPT (HCMC VNPT) is the subsidiary of VNPT, one of the leading
system telecommunication in Vietnam. In Ho Chi Minh City, HCMC VNPT has been
operating for many years and providing well service to many customers. Given the fact
that there are big opportunities as Vietnam is growing fast and more investment in the
telecommunications industry is expected, it is necessary for HCMC VNPT to maintain
competitive and increase market share. The thesis therefore goes deeply into analyzing the
internal and external environment of the company for MegaVNN service which is one of
key service of HCMC VNPT to find the fittest strategy for the company and then apply to
marketing plan.

The thesis firstly conducts an external audit of the company environment to figure out
opportunities and threats. Following the external audit, an internal audit is done to illustrate
the strengths and weaknesses. Putting altogether, the Quantitative Strategic Planning
Matrix is built up to choose the best suitable strategies among four strategic, service
development, service diversification, trademark building and development investment
strategy. To make the study more realistic and objective, one surveys and interview are
conducted. The result of the surveys and information collected from direct interview are
consolidated into the Quantitative Strategic Planning Matrix.

Based on main findings from the Quantitative Strategic Planning Matrix, differentiation
strategy was chosen then apply to marketing –mix for building marketing plan for
MegaVNN service. Some recommendations have then been suggested to build marketing
plan for HCMC VNPT.

The demand for internet is now very necessary and large, so it opens up a market for
service providers. The main services that the providers such as VNPT, FPT Telecom and
Viettel provide customers access to internet are ADSL and Fiber. ADSL service in which
direction to individual customers and households, small and medium businesses (B2C) and
Fiber towards large enterprises high-traffic use.
Currently, the field of internet service, MegaVNN (ADSL) is leading with over 75%
market share in Vietnam and 45% market share in Ho Chi Minh City.
However, in consecutive years, ADSL market growth has been rated as explosion, growth
in numbers of subscriber after doubling last year. In particular, the market is still largely in
the hands of the three largest firms is VNPT, FPT Telecom and Viettel.
To appeal, throughout the year, the ADSL service providers have launched big promotions.
Such as free trial / donate modem, free connection fee, monthly subscription-free, even
given the charge months of continuous use applied.
2

Customer wait and use promotional free modem, use a few more months of service not
worry freight, after that to find the opportunity to continue to be "free" at the other
supplier. They are willing to cut to cancel service when all benefits are empty.
To alleviate this situation, now, companies are researching all incentives. Such as the
network will not be rushing more promotions that focus on key markets. For existing
subscribers, although not to the saturation point, but also should be more concerned to
retain.
And another consideration must also be emphasized; there is pressure to refresh you, from
quality issues to the content provider. By now, too many choices, users are becoming more
demanding with an ADSL service as well as with service providers.

According Prof. Philip Kotler: ”We can distinguish between a social and a managerial
definition for marketing. According to a social definition, marketing is a societal process
by which individuals and groups obtain what they need and want through creating,
offering, and exchanging products and services of value freely with others. As a
managerial definition, marketing has often been described as “the art of selling products” -
Philip Kotler "Marketing Management Millennium Edition"
To better understand the concept we must answer the following questions: What is needs?
What is wants? What is Demand?
- Needs: describe basic human requirements such as food, air, water, clothing, and
shelter. People also have strong needs for recreation, education, and entertainment
- Wants: These needs become wants when they are directed to specific objects that
might satisfy the need. An American needs food but wants a hamburger, French fries,
and a soft drink. A person in Mauritius needs food but wants a mango, rice, lentils, and
beans. Clearly, wants are shaped by one’s society.
6

- Demands: are wants for specific products backed by an ability to pay. Many people
want a Mercedes; only a few are able and willing to buy one. Companies must measure
not only how many people want their product, but also how many would actually be
willing and able to buy it.

2.2.2 Micro environment
Micro environment is the environment attached to each enterprise and most of the
operations and competitions of enterprises are in this environment. The main factors of this
environment are competitors in the industry, customers, suppliers, implicit competitors and
substitutes.
The competition pressure in the industry will determine the investment size, competition
intensity and profitability of the industry. Once the pressure of any of them goes up, the
profit of enterprise will be under pressure of going down and vice versa. Thus, the analysis
process needs to realize the substance and the impacts of the pressures; it will help the
enterprises in defining the appropriate strategy to cope with its competitors.
In summary, environment analysis helps to be aware of opportunities and threats,
difficulties and challenges for enterprises, strengths and weakness of competitors and other
pressures in process of building strategy. Those factors need to be summarized and
quantified through External Factors Evaluation (EFE) matrix and competitive profile
matrix.

We mention four levels of the product:
First: The core benefits of the product, is the service or benefit the customers actually buy.
In the specific case of MegaVNN, product is to provide high-speed internet access for
customers to use.
Second: The specific products that include attributes related to tangible products: such as
design, packaging, quality, characteristics used to distinguish different products on the
market. The specific part that is the commitment table which designs service quality,
speed internet access, leased line connection Internet, the modem, computer, network card.
Third: A supplement to the product, including additional attributes to products to attract
customers, often invisible attributes, spare parts, warranty and after sales service, delivery
and the trust. MegaVNN services support to clients 24/24, installed at home, promotions,
providing modem, provide email accounts…
Fourth: product potential, showing the efforts, the manufacturer promises strive to add the

profitability.
